Created attachment 603053[details]
engine.log
ovirt-engine-backend: java.lang.NoSuchMethodException: compensation is not implemanted for AddImageFromScratchCommand.
Scenario:
**********
1) Add VM from Blank.
2) Add to VM Several Virtual HardDisks (one by one)
3) While the Tasks 'createVolume' running on the SPM host restart the 'ovirt-engine' service.
Results:
********
each AddImageFromScratchCommand throws - java.lang.NoSuchMethodException.
Engine.log
***********
2012-08-08 15:10:54,078 INFO [org.ovirt.engine.core.bll.Backend] (MSC service thread 1-2) Start time: 8/8/12 3:10 PM
2012-08-08 15:10:54,139 ERROR [org.ovirt.engine.core.bll.CommandsFactory] (MSC service thread 1-2) CommandsFactory : Failed to get type information using reflection for Class : org.ovirt.engine.core.bll.AddImageFromScratchCommand, Command Id:ae13a977-9aae-4ab1-b372-18921318103f: java.lang.NoSuchMethodException: org.ovirt.engine.core.bll.AddImageFromScratchCommand.<init>(org.ovirt.engine.core.compat.Guid)
at java.lang.Class.getConstructor0(Class.java:2721) [rt.jar:1.7.0_03-icedtea]
at java.lang.Class.getDeclaredConstructor(Class.java:2002) [rt.jar:1.7.0_03-icedtea]
at org.ovirt.engine.core.bll.CommandsFactory.CreateCommand(CommandsFactory.java:63) [engine-bll.jar:]
at org.ovirt.engine.core.bll.Backend.compensate(Backend.java:265) [engine-bll.jar:]
at org.ovirt.engine.core.bll.Backend.Initialize(Backend.java:166) [engine-bll.jar:]
at org.ovirt.engine.core.bll.Backend.create(Backend.java:118) [engine-bll.jar:]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.7.0_03-icedtea]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) [rt.jar:1.7.0_03-icedtea]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.7.0_03-icedtea]
at java.lang.reflect.Method.invoke(Method.java:601) [rt.jar:1.7.0_03-icedtea]
at org.jboss.as.ee.component.ManagedReferenceLifecycleMethodInterceptorFactory$ManagedReferenceLifecycleMethodInterceptor.processInvocation(ManagedReferenceLifecycleMethodInterceptorFactory.java:130) [jboss-as-ee.jar:7.1.2.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.as.ee.component.ManagedReferenceFieldInjectionInterceptorFactory$ManagedReferenceFieldInjectionInterceptor.processInvocation(ManagedReferenceFieldInjectionInterceptorFactory.java:112) [jboss-as-ee.jar:7.1.2.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.as.ee.component.ManagedReferenceInterceptorFactory$ManagedReferenceInterceptor.processInvocation(ManagedReferenceInterceptorFactory.java:95) [jboss-as-ee.jar:7.1.2.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.as.ee.component.ManagedReferenceInterceptorFactory$ManagedReferenceInterceptor.processInvocation(ManagedReferenceInterceptorFactory.java:95) [jboss-as-ee.jar:7.1.2.Final-redhat-1]
at
..
..
..
..
2012-08-08 15:10:54,142 ERROR [org.ovirt.engine.core.bll.Backend] (MSC service thread 1-2) Failed to run compensation on startup for Command org.ovirt.engine.core.bll.AddImageFromScratchCommand , Command Id : ae13a977-9aae-4ab1-b372-18921318103f
2012-08-08 15:10:54,143 ERROR [org.ovirt.engine.core.bll.CommandsFactory] (MSC service thread 1-2) CommandsFactory : Failed to get type information using reflection for Class : org.ovirt.engine.core.bll.AddImageFromScratchCommand, Command Id:204f263d-2ec7-471f-83c9-1124a4fc1806: java.lang.NoSuchMethodException: org.ovirt.engine.core.bll.AddImageFromScratchCommand.<init>(org.ovirt.engine.core.compat.Guid)
at java.lang.Class.getConstructor0(Class.java:2721) [rt.jar:1.7.0_03-icedtea]
at java.lang.Class.getDeclaredConstructor(Class.java:2002) [rt.jar:1.7.0_03-icedtea]
at org.ovirt.engine.core.bll.CommandsFactory.CreateCommand(CommandsFactory.java:63) [engine-bll.jar:]
at org.ovirt.engine.core.bll.Backend.compensate(Backend.java:265) [engine-bll.jar:]
at org.ovirt.engine.core.bll.Backend.Initialize(Backend.java:166) [engine-bll.jar:]
at org.ovirt.engine.core.bll.Backend.create(Backend.java:118) [engine-bll.jar:]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.7.0_03-icedtea]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) [rt.jar:1.7.0_03-icedtea]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.7.0_03-icedtea]
at java.lang.reflect.Method.invoke(Method.java:601) [rt.jar:1.7.0_03-icedtea]
at org.jboss.as.ee.component.ManagedReferenceLifecycleMethodInterceptorFactory$ManagedReferenceLifecycleMethodInterceptor.processInvocation(ManagedReferenceLifecycleMethodInterceptorFactory.java:130) [jboss-as-ee.jar:7.1.2.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.as.ee.component.ManagedReferenceFieldInjectionInterceptorFactory$ManagedReferenceFieldInjectionInterceptor.processInvocation(ManagedReferenceFieldInjectionInterceptorFactory.java:112) [jboss-as-ee.jar:7.1.2.Final-redhat-1]
at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1]
at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1]
Created attachment 603053 [details] engine.log ovirt-engine-backend: java.lang.NoSuchMethodException: compensation is not implemanted for AddImageFromScratchCommand. Scenario: ********** 1) Add VM from Blank. 2) Add to VM Several Virtual HardDisks (one by one) 3) While the Tasks 'createVolume' running on the SPM host restart the 'ovirt-engine' service. Results: ******** each AddImageFromScratchCommand throws - java.lang.NoSuchMethodException. Engine.log *********** 2012-08-08 15:10:54,078 INFO [org.ovirt.engine.core.bll.Backend] (MSC service thread 1-2) Start time: 8/8/12 3:10 PM 2012-08-08 15:10:54,139 ERROR [org.ovirt.engine.core.bll.CommandsFactory] (MSC service thread 1-2) CommandsFactory : Failed to get type information using reflection for Class : org.ovirt.engine.core.bll.AddImageFromScratchCommand, Command Id:ae13a977-9aae-4ab1-b372-18921318103f: java.lang.NoSuchMethodException: org.ovirt.engine.core.bll.AddImageFromScratchCommand.<init>(org.ovirt.engine.core.compat.Guid) at java.lang.Class.getConstructor0(Class.java:2721) [rt.jar:1.7.0_03-icedtea] at java.lang.Class.getDeclaredConstructor(Class.java:2002) [rt.jar:1.7.0_03-icedtea] at org.ovirt.engine.core.bll.CommandsFactory.CreateCommand(CommandsFactory.java:63) [engine-bll.jar:] at org.ovirt.engine.core.bll.Backend.compensate(Backend.java:265) [engine-bll.jar:] at org.ovirt.engine.core.bll.Backend.Initialize(Backend.java:166) [engine-bll.jar:] at org.ovirt.engine.core.bll.Backend.create(Backend.java:118) [engine-bll.jar:]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.7.0_03-icedtea]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) [rt.jar:1.7.0_03-icedtea]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.7.0_03-icedtea] at java.lang.reflect.Method.invoke(Method.java:601) [rt.jar:1.7.0_03-icedtea] at org.jboss.as.ee.component.ManagedReferenceLifecycleMethodInterceptorFactory$ManagedReferenceLifecycleMethodInterceptor.processInvocation(ManagedReferenceLifecycleMethodInterceptorFactory.java:130) [jboss-as-ee.jar:7.1.2.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.as.ee.component.ManagedReferenceFieldInjectionInterceptorFactory$ManagedReferenceFieldInjectionInterceptor.processInvocation(ManagedReferenceFieldInjectionInterceptorFactory.java:112) [jboss-as-ee.jar:7.1.2.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.as.ee.component.ManagedReferenceInterceptorFactory$ManagedReferenceInterceptor.processInvocation(ManagedReferenceInterceptorFactory.java:95) [jboss-as-ee.jar:7.1.2.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.as.ee.component.ManagedReferenceInterceptorFactory$ManagedReferenceInterceptor.processInvocation(ManagedReferenceInterceptorFactory.java:95) [jboss-as-ee.jar:7.1.2.Final-redhat-1] at .. .. .. .. 2012-08-08 15:10:54,142 ERROR [org.ovirt.engine.core.bll.Backend] (MSC service thread 1-2) Failed to run compensation on startup for Command org.ovirt.engine.core.bll.AddImageFromScratchCommand , Command Id : ae13a977-9aae-4ab1-b372-18921318103f 2012-08-08 15:10:54,143 ERROR [org.ovirt.engine.core.bll.CommandsFactory] (MSC service thread 1-2) CommandsFactory : Failed to get type information using reflection for Class : org.ovirt.engine.core.bll.AddImageFromScratchCommand, Command Id:204f263d-2ec7-471f-83c9-1124a4fc1806: java.lang.NoSuchMethodException: org.ovirt.engine.core.bll.AddImageFromScratchCommand.<init>(org.ovirt.engine.core.compat.Guid) at java.lang.Class.getConstructor0(Class.java:2721) [rt.jar:1.7.0_03-icedtea] at java.lang.Class.getDeclaredConstructor(Class.java:2002) [rt.jar:1.7.0_03-icedtea] at org.ovirt.engine.core.bll.CommandsFactory.CreateCommand(CommandsFactory.java:63) [engine-bll.jar:] at org.ovirt.engine.core.bll.Backend.compensate(Backend.java:265) [engine-bll.jar:] at org.ovirt.engine.core.bll.Backend.Initialize(Backend.java:166) [engine-bll.jar:] at org.ovirt.engine.core.bll.Backend.create(Backend.java:118) [engine-bll.jar:]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) [rt.jar:1.7.0_03-icedtea]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) [rt.jar:1.7.0_03-icedtea]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) [rt.jar:1.7.0_03-icedtea] at java.lang.reflect.Method.invoke(Method.java:601) [rt.jar:1.7.0_03-icedtea] at org.jboss.as.ee.component.ManagedReferenceLifecycleMethodInterceptorFactory$ManagedReferenceLifecycleMethodInterceptor.processInvocation(ManagedReferenceLifecycleMethodInterceptorFactory.java:130) [jboss-as-ee.jar:7.1.2.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.as.ee.component.ManagedReferenceFieldInjectionInterceptorFactory$ManagedReferenceFieldInjectionInterceptor.processInvocation(ManagedReferenceFieldInjectionInterceptorFactory.java:112) [jboss-as-ee.jar:7.1.2.Final-redhat-1] at org.jboss.invocation.InterceptorContext.proceed(InterceptorContext.java:288) [jboss-invocation.jar:1.1.1.Final-redhat-1] at org.jboss.invocation.WeavedInterceptor.processInvocation(WeavedInterceptor.java:53) [jboss-invocation.jar:1.1.1.Final-redhat-1]